The Pentagon Papers

The Pentagon Papers, officially titled "Report of the Office of the Secretary of Defense Vietnam Task Force", was commissioned by Secretary of Defense Robert McNamara in 1967.

This classified report was leaked to the media in 1971 by Daniel Ellsberg. It was finally declassified in 2011, when the National Archives and Records Administration released the complete text of the report for the first time.
